GreaterGamersLounge/bot_man

View on GitHub

Showing 2 of 7 total issues

Class BaseEventContainer has 26 methods (exceeds 20 allowed). Consider refactoring.
Open

class BaseEventContainer < ContainerWrapper
extend Discordrb::EventContainer
 
# TODO: Get define_method working for
# an array of methods with the same signature
Severity: Minor
Found in lib/bot/events/base_event_container.rb - About 3 hrs to fix

    Method lev has a Cognitive Complexity of 8 (exceeds 5 allowed). Consider refactoring.
    Open

    def self.lev(string1, string2, memo = {})
    return memo[[string1, string2]] if memo[[string1, string2]]
    return string2.size if string1.empty?
    return string1.size if string2.empty?
     
     
    Severity: Minor
    Found in lib/bot/commands/mass_move_container.rb - About 45 mins to fix
    Severity
    Category
    Status
    Source
    Language